The Sky Sports Live Football Score Centre app not only brings you match data and latest scores for all UK and European league and cup competitions, but it also provides you with team line-ups.

You’ll be easily able to access breaking news, details of fixtures and results, live scores, tables and standings, and as well as this users of the app can receive notifications on up to 4 teams for all the important moments. It features a ‘My Scores’ page for you to choose matches you particularly want to follow and your home screen can even be personalized with the latest info on your team.

Further features of the app are commentary, match stats, match previews and match reports. Therefore if you want to find out who is likely to be playing alongside Steven Gerrard in midfield or whether Adam Lallana will feature up front this is the app to use to find out.
